WebChildren's Hospice Association Scotland (CHAS) is a charity that provides the only hospice services in Scotland for children and young people who have life-shortening conditions for which there is no known cure. CHAS runs two children’s hospices and a home care service called CHAS at Home. WebThames Hospice provides palliative and end-of-life care services to people aged 16 and over across Berkshire and South Buckinghamshire. It costs £12 million every year to keep our Hospice running. We rely on charitable support for over 50% of the funds we need annually to continue to provide our services free of charge to everyone who needs us. The majority of hospice care is provided in community-based settings, including home care/hospice at home, outpatient services and hospice day care. Hospices provide a range of services which may include: • pain and symptom control • 24 hour end of life care

WebThere is a limited number of beds in each hospice, so there may be a waiting list.
